Cylinders synchronisation
The control unit knows the intake pressures in the
four ducts due to the two pressure sensors: know-
ing the cylinder operating phases, it is able to
distinguish the individual pressures of the four cyl-
inders.
The control unit is able to adjust the balancing of
the vacuums between the cylinders of the front
bank and those of the rear bank due to the two
independent throttle body motors, but is not able
to balance the pressures of the master cylinder
(the one closest to the motor) and the slave cylin-
der.
If there is even a minimum irregularity, it is possible to check and possibly adjust the by - pass screws
to correctly balance the cylinders 1-3 and 2-4.
With the diagnostic tool, select cylinder pressure balancing from the Adjustable parameters screen
page.
In order for the procedure to start:
the engine water temperature must be higher than 80 °C (176 °F);
the engine must be idling;
there must not be any errors in the control unit.
When the fans turn on (approx. 101°C - 214°F) the procedure is stopped and cannot be performed.
During the procedure, the position of the handle sensor is not considered.
A screen is displayed indicating the By-pass
screws for cylinders 1 and 3 and whether the
screw setting is correct, or whether it must be
opened/closed by a small (1/8 turn) or large (1/4
turn) amount.
If the measure is related the Slave screws, (2-3
cylinder) any removal is useless.
